HopeWest CEO honored
MEEKER I Christy Whitney, President and CEO of HopeWest, a Colorado non-profit hospice and palliative care organization, was recently honored with the Community Visionary Award from the Grand Junction Chamber of Commerce.
Meeker girls’ basketball team enters regionals as No. 5 seed
MEEKER I Since ending the regular season with an 8-4 league record and finishing sixth in the league standings, the Meeker High School girls’ basketball team had to play two must-win games last week to enter the regional tournament. They did what they needed.

Meeker youth wrestling registration Friday
MEEKER I The Meeker Community Youth Wrestling club will register wrestlers pre-K through sixth grade on Friday, March 6 at 6 p.m., at the high school cafeteria. Practice starts March 9 at 6 p.m. and the Casey Turner Memorial tournament will be held April 25.
